原理:
查看了下安卓源码,明白了解析过程,只是自己的话就要移植安卓的源码,有人解析成功了,但是我觉得太麻烦。
大概说下安卓的解析过程吧。
public PackageInfo getPackageArchiveInfo(String archiveFilePath, int flags) {
PackageParser packageParser = new Pack...
分类:
移动开发 时间:
2015-03-28 10:11:48
阅读次数:
212
一、从扮演浏览器开始 扮演浏览器是Head First图书中很有意义的一个环节。可作者忘记了告诉我们扮演浏览器的台本。我们从这里开始。 上图是webkit内核渲染html和css的流程图。从该图我们可以知道以下几个关键信息: HTML的解析过程和CSS的解析过程是独立完成的。HTML被解析成DOM树...
分类:
Web程序 时间:
2015-03-18 01:00:08
阅读次数:
258
原创文章,转载请写明出处,多谢!
以下分析基于jQuery-1.10.2.js版本。
下面将以$("div:not(.class:contain('span')):eq(3)")为例,说明tokenize和preFilter各段代码是如何协调完成解析的。若想了解tokenize方法和preFilter类的每行代码的详细解释,请参看如下两篇文章:
jQuery选择器代码详解(三)——token...
分类:
Web程序 时间:
2015-02-14 01:06:50
阅读次数:
166
最近在做一个操作SVN的Web系统,涉及到了很多东西,包括apache执行命令、配置文件解析等;编码过程中发现svn的权限解析过程和我所了解到的不大相同,在网上查了一些资料,但好像都是怎么配置svn,没有详细讲解权限的生效过程,而我开发系统需要考虑到各种情况,所以我自己通过一部分资料和动手实验总.....
分类:
其他好文 时间:
2015-01-28 22:36:55
阅读次数:
299
1. !优先级高于== 所以先执行![].根据标准:The productionUnaryExpression:!UnaryExpressionis evaluated as follows:Letexprbe the result of evaluatingUnaryExpression.Leto...
分类:
其他好文 时间:
2015-01-20 21:56:12
阅读次数:
177
我们这一章讲SpringMVC中文件上传的应用,首先我们还是从DispatcherServlet这个核心分发器开始讲起:
processedRequest = checkMultipart(request);
还记得上一章讲doDispatch这个方法时见过的方法吧?现在我们来分析下这个方法的具体解析过程:
protected HttpServletRequest checkMult...
分类:
编程语言 时间:
2015-01-20 00:59:45
阅读次数:
210
不经意的时候看到路由器里面有个动态域名,后来网上一查知道是可以建立个人网站,然后让网络上的其它用户可以访问自己开设的服务器,比如自己建立的网站等,那么怎么才能利用它来实现动态域名呢?开启花生壳解析过程百度搜如下图的内容,并访问它的官网点击“注册”如下图所示,在在胡册窗口填入你的信息。注册好它的用户,...
分类:
其他好文 时间:
2015-01-15 17:52:28
阅读次数:
142
h1,h2,h3,h4,h5,h6,p,blockquote { margin: 0; padding: 0;}body { font-family: "Helvetica Neue", Helvetica, "Hiragino Sans GB", Arial, sans-serif; font-size: 13px; line-height: 18px; co...
分类:
移动开发 时间:
2015-01-05 18:45:44
阅读次数:
513
先来张大图:结合上图来说明一下解析的各个步骤涉及的锁。软解析、硬解析、软软解析区别的简单说明:为了将用户写的sql文本转化为oracle认识的且可执行的语句,这个过程就叫做解析过程。解析分为硬解析和软解析,SQL语句第一次解析时必须进行硬解析一句话说明硬解析与软解析的区别是:硬解析=需要生成执行计划...
分类:
数据库 时间:
2014-12-30 11:21:18
阅读次数:
179